15 Ibbetson Path, Loughton, IG10 2AS is a freehold terraced property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 646 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£394,748 , which equates to approximately £611 per square foot. It was last sold on 10 Dec 2018 for £345,000. Since then, the value has increased by £49,748, representing a 14.4% increase, or approximately 2.1% per year.

The current estimated value of £394,748 is:

  • 6.5% lower than the average property price on Ibbetson Path
  • 14.9% lower than the average in the IG10 2AS postcode area
  • and 35.2% lower than the average price for Loughton as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 10 October 2018,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

15 Ibbetson Path, Loughton, Epping Forest, Essex, IG10 2AS has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 10 Oct 2018.

This property uses a gas boiler with underfloor heating as its main heating source. It is connected to mains gas.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ully triple gl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 21 Nov 2010,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 13.1%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system changed from boiler and radiators, mains gas to boiler and underfloor heating, mains gas,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to roof room(s), ins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The windows were upgraded from fully double glazed to fully triple glazed.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in all f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 86% of f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
